Don't get defeated by the overhead press. It's going to be your weakest lift, by default. What's your program, I forgot.

If you're separating Bench/Dead/Squat/OHP then separate bench and ohp as much as possible. Your soreness from bench can be a detriment to OHP.

If you're doing Starting Strength and focusing on the A workout, expect your overhead press to be weak. I'm sure on the weeks that you start with the B workout after rest your overhead press is better.
